UNPUBLISHED UNITED STATES COURT OF APPEALS FOR THE FOURTH CIRCUIT No. 14-1238 In re: GREG P. GIVENS, Petitioner. On Petition for Extraordinary Writ. (No. 5:12-cv-00155-FPS-JES) Submitted: July 24, 2014 Before FLOYD and Circuit Judge. THACKER, Decided: July 28, 2014 Circuit Judges, and DAVIS, Senior Petition denied by unpublished per curiam opinion. Greg P. Givens, Petitioner Pro Se. Unpublished opinions are not binding precedent in this circuit. PER CURIAM: Greg P. Givens petitions for a writ of procedendo, which has been docketed as a petition for an extraordinary writ. We conclude that relief is not warranted. Accordingly, we grant Givens motion to proceed in forma pauperis, grant his motion to file electronic media, deny his motion to carry a device into the courtroom, and deny the petition. recording We dispense with oral argument because the facts and legal contentions are adequately presented in the materials before this court and argument would not aid the decisional process. PETITION DENIED 2
